Review Comment:
   The original check (== NULL) is actually correct. However, the original implementation is very difficult to follow and understand. I can't know how it was supposed to work, only that it was broken.
   
   Without this check, i.e. unconditionally setting 
   
   `regs[REG_SP]  = (uintptr_t)rtcb->xcp.kstack + ARCH_KERNEL_STACKSIZE;`
   
   Destroys the entire kernel stack frame, because it resets the stack pointer to stack top. If rtcb->xcp.kstkptr == NULL we know that no one is using the kernel stack atm and we can set the stack to stack top. Otherwise we should not touch regs[REG_SP].
